Big Easy Sod supplies Bermuda Grass Sod, Centipede Grass Sod, St. Augustine Grass Sod, and Zoysia Grass Sod, each with characteristics suited to different property environments and maintenance requirements.

St. Augustine grass is noted for its ability to thrive in warm and humid climates, featuring a deep green color and thick texture. Bermuda grass offers durability and drought tolerance, making it suitable for high-traffic areas and locations where water restrictions may apply during dry periods. The variety selection allows property owners to match grass types to their specific soil conditions and sunlight exposure levels.
Sod installation differs from traditional seeding in its establishment timeline. Seeding methods require weeks or months for grass to grow, while sod provides immediate coverage once installed. This timeline difference makes sod relevant for property owners with time-sensitive landscaping needs, including those preparing outdoor spaces for scheduled events or gatherings.
Big Easy Sod has established installation protocols beginning with soil preparation. The process includes removal of rocks, debris, and weeds, followed by loosening the top soil layer. The company recommends soil testing to determine pH levels and nutrient content before installation. Proper preparation allows adhesion that prevents new sod from cracking, raising, or sinking after installation is complete.
The installation method involves unrolling sod along the longest straight edge of the lawn, with each roll butted tightly against the previous one to eliminate gaps or overlaps. The sod is patted down to ensure soil contact, promoting root establishment. Watering immediately after installation prevents drying, with soil moistened to a depth of four to six inches for adequate hydration.
Post-installation care follows a defined schedule. Daily watering continues for the first two weeks, with frequency gradually reduced as roots establish. Big Easy Sod recommends waiting at least two weeks before mowing, with blade settings maintained at the highest level to avoid cutting grass too short. Regular mowing every seven to ten days promotes healthy growth, with no more than one-third of grass blade length removed at any time to prevent stress on the newly installed sod.
The company's sod products provide functional benefits including soil quality improvement and erosion control. Sod also reduces dust and absorbs noise, characteristics relevant to urban properties. The consistent thickness and density of cultivated sod creates even surfaces suitable for outdoor activities and regular lawn use.
Selecting the appropriate grass type depends on factors including climate, soil type, and sunlight exposure on the property. Big Easy Sod advises property owners to consider their specific lawn conditions when choosing between the four available grass types, as each variety has different maintenance requirements and tolerances for local weather patterns.
